#AugustCoreCPIBeatsExpectations
📊 August Core CPI Beats Expectations
U.S. August Core CPI came in at 0.3% MoM, above the 0.2% expected, while annual core inflation eased to 2.4% from 2.5%.
The hotter monthly reading could keep pressure on the Fed and may increase expectations for a more cautious rate-cut path. Higher-for-longer rates could create short-term volatility across risk assets, including crypto.
However, with annual core inflation continuing to ease, markets will be watching upcoming inflation and Fed signals closely. 📈

#AugustCoreCPIBeatsExpectations
August inflation data has delivered an important signal for global financial markets.
U.S. Core CPI increased 0.3% month-over-month in August, beating the 0.2% market expectation. On a yearly basis, core inflation came in at 2.4%, down from 2.5% in July but still above the Federal Reserve’s 2% inflation target.
The headline CPI also increased 0.4% in August, exactly matching expectations, while annual headline inflation remained at 3.4%.
At first glance, a 0.3% monthly core CPI number may not look dramatic.
